marritt and ombler foundation
The charity supports children and young people and people with disabilities. Marritt And Ombler Foundation is a registered charity whose purpose is education and training. It delivers its work by making grants to individuals. The charity is based in Hull and operates in East Riding Of Yorkshire.

Activities & Mission
Marritt and Ombler Foundation gives financial awards to children under 25 living and/or educated in Keyingham to help with educational, social. physical and emotional development.
